Spot rubber improves on covering groups

Print this page Posted on : 10-25-2007 by recycleinme.com
Spot prices turned better on Monday. Sheet rubber improved to Rs.90 from Rs.89 and Rs.89.50 a kg respectively at Kottayam and Kochi as a leading tyre company came forward to procure the grade up to the quoted level. Covering groups and purchase agents were active once again following the re-entry of major manufacturers after a gap. The market made all-round gains on better demand.

FUTURES GAIN

The rubber futures moved up on NMCE. The October contract improved to Rs.89.15 (88.30), November to Rs.86.40 (86.02), December to Rs.86.45 (86.03) and January to Rs.87 (86.42) a kg for RSS 4. Spot prices were (Rs./kg) : RSS-4 : 90 (89); RSS-5: 87.50 (87); ungraded : 85(84); ISNT 20: 86.50 (86) and latex 60 per cent : 61.55 (60.50)
